Dana McKay & Damiano Spina

Dr. Dana McKay is associate dean, interaction, technology and information at RMIT's School of Computing Technologies. Dana's primary interest is in ensuring that advances in information technology make the world fairer and more equitable. To do this she focuses on how people interact with information, and how technology shapes that interaction. Recent projects include studying the role of technology in family violence (and how to prevent it), how online information affects people’s views, and how to improve browsing tools so you can finally find something good to watch on Netflix. Before completing her PhD in 2019 Dana spent 10 years working as a UX professional.

Damiano Spina is a Senior Lecturer at RMIT University (School of Computing Technologies), an Associate Investigator at the ARC Centre of Excellence for Automated Decision-Making and Society, RMIT Research Leader at the Australian Internet Observatory, and a Member of the Association for Computing Machinery (ACM).
